Spicy Mexican Corn Bites – Crispy, Cheesy & Packed with Flavor!

  • Total Time: 35 minutes

Description

These Spicy Mexican Corn Bites are crispy, cheesy, and full of bold flavors! A perfect appetizer for parties, game nights, or snacking.


Ingredients

Scale

For the Corn Mixture:

  • 1 ½ cups sweet corn (fresh, canned, or thawed frozen)
  • ½ cup shredded Mexican cheese blend (cheddar, Monterey Jack, or queso fresco)
  • ¼ cup cream cheese, softened
  • 1 small jalapeño, finely diced (adjust for spice level)
  •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on cumin
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 cup crushed tortilla chips or panko breadcrumbs

For the Coating:

  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1 cup panko breadcrumbs (or crushed tortilla chips)

For Frying (Optional):

  • 1 cup vegetable oil (if frying)

For Serving:

  • Sour cream or lime crema
  • Guacamole or salsa
  • Fresh cilantro and lime wedges

Instructions

1. Prepare the Corn Mixture

  1. In a bowl, mix corn, shredded cheese, cream cheese, jalapeño, smoked paprika, garlic powder, cumin, salt, black pepper, and crushed tortilla chips.
  2. Stir until well combined and a thick, sticky mixture forms.

2. Shape the Bites

  1. Scoop out 1-inch portions of the mixture and roll into balls.
  2. Place them on a parchment-lined baking sheet and refrigerate for 15-20 minutes to firm up.

3. Coat the Corn Bites

  1. Roll each ball in flour, then dip in beaten egg, and coat with panko breadcrumbs.

4. Cook the Spicy Mexican Corn Bites

Baking Method (Healthier Option):

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Arrange the coated corn bites on a greased or parchment-lined baking sheet.
  3. Lightly spray with cooking oil for extra crispiness.
  4. Bake for 18-20 minutes, flipping halfway, until golden brown and crispy.

Frying Method (Extra Crunchy Option):

  1. Heat vegetable oil in a deep skillet or fryer to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Fry in small batches for 2-3 minutes, turning occasionally, until golden brown.
  3. Remove and drain on paper towels.

Air Fryer Method (Crispy & Light):

  1. Preheat air fryer to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Arrange bites in a single layer and spray lightly with oil.
  3. Air fry for 8-10 minutes, shaking halfway through, until crispy.

5. Serve & Enjoy!

  • Garnish with fresh cilantro and lime wedges.
  • Serve with sour cream, salsa, or guacamole for dipping.

Notes

Use fresh corn – It adds the best natural sweetness and crunch.
Chill before frying – This helps the bites hold their shape.
Double-coat for extra crispiness – Repeat the egg and breadcrumb step for a crunchier bite.
